概括
在COVID-19大流行期间在家工作并没有改变整体睡眠卫生分数. 然而,特定的睡眠卫生习惯恶化了,而其他习惯则改善了,影响了睡眠质量.

背景情况:
- 了解远程工作者的睡眠卫生和质量至关重要,特别是在COVID-19后的流行病.
- 在大流行期间广泛转向在家工作,为研究睡眠模式提供了一个独特的模型.
研究的目的:
- 在COVID-19大流行开始时,评估从家工作的人的睡眠卫生习惯和自我报告的睡眠质量.
- 识别与过渡到远程工作相关的睡眠卫生和睡眠质量的变化.
主要方法:
- 对204名参与者进行了一项横截面的基于网络的调查.
- 睡眠卫生指数 (SHI) 和匹兹堡睡眠质量指数 (PSQI) 用于衡量睡眠卫生和质量.
- 收集的数据包括社会人口统计学变量和个人习惯,如运动和咖啡因摄入量.
主要成果:
- 51%的参与者报告有明显的睡眠障碍 (PSQI>5).
- 在PSQI和SHI得分之间发现了显著的正相关性 (p < 0.001).
- 虽然整体SHI得分保持不变,但特定组件显示睡眠卫生实践的恶化和改善.
结论:
- 在家工作没有改变总睡眠卫生分数,但导致特定睡眠卫生行为的混合变化.
- 这些发现强调了需要有针对性的干预措施来改善远程工作者睡眠卫生.
- 需要进一步的研究来探索远程工作对睡眠健康的长期影响.

Insomnia
87
Insomnia is a prevalent sleep disorder characterized by difficulty falling asleep, frequent awakenings during the night, and waking up too early without being able to return to sleep. People with insomnia often experience these disruptions at least three nights a week for at least one month. Chronic insomnia, which lasts for at least three months, can lead to increased anxiety, which in turn can worsen sleep difficulties, creating a cycle of sleeplessness and stress.

Sleepwalking and Sleep Talking
168
Somnambulism, commonly known as sleepwalking, involves individuals engaging in activities ranging from simple walking to more complex behaviors such as driving. Sleepwalking typically occurs during the slow-wave sleep stages 3 and 4 early in the night when the person is not dreaming, contradicting the myth that sleepwalkers are acting out their dreams.
